Bobby Cuddy's pace was slowed twice more by minor cautions but he raced to the win despite late pressure from Auburndale Speedway regular Bobby Mobley who was very impressive in his first run here. Point leader David Gould continued his string of strong finishes taking third. Gould has finished no worse than fourth in the seven outings for the Super Stocks this year.

Three time Speedworld Legends Car champion Kory Abbott made his first appearance of the year but his team was debating whether to load up or race after discovering a cracked head in warm-ups. Abbott made the decision to race and try and break the win streak of Alex Kempf. After starting dead-last in the field, Abbott took the lead from Gary Verdier on lap two. One lap later, Verdier and Kempf tangled on the front stretch sending both to the back of the restart line-up.

Kempf would then take a second trip to the back after crossing paths with Rick Wetmore on lap ten. Abbott looked to have the race in the bag, pulling out to a big lead on the restart only to have his engine explode in a ball of flame on lap twelve.

Abbott scampered out unscathed but his decision to race ultimately proved to be costly. Zach Harris found himself out front for the restart but it took Kempf just one lap to speed past and secure his fourth consecutive Legends win.
